Multiple Explosions Rock Southern Iran Amid Rising Regional Tensions
A tense night unfolded in the Middle East as a series of powerful explosions struck strategic locations across southern Iran, accompanied by widespread GPS disruptions in the Persian Gulf region. The incidents occurred overnight between Saturday and Sunday, affecting several key cities including Bushehr, Asaluyeh, Chabahar, Bandar Abbas, Kangan, and Minab.
The most alarming reports came from the Bushehr area, where local sources indicated a significant attack near the nuclear power plant. Concurrently, foreign media and communication networks suggested that missile fire may have been launched from U.S. bases in Bahrain targeting Iranian sites. Additionally, Iranian authorities reported an assault on a police station in the city of Hovaz.
The GPS interference experienced by residents and aircraft in the Persian Gulf is typically associated with extensive military operations, underscoring the heightened state of conflict in the region. These developments mark a sharp escalation in tensions between Iran and external forces, with potential implications for regional security.
